The proposed $22.5 billion overhaul of Dulles International Airport is a necessary step toward modernizing a critical infrastructure asset. By replacing outdated concourses and eliminating inefficient "people movers," the plan aims to enhance passenger experience and accommodate future growth. Preserving the main terminal designed by Eero Saarinen ensures the retention of architectural heritage while upgrading facilities to meet contemporary standards. United Airlines' support underscores the project's potential to improve operational efficiency and service quality. The anticipated construction timeline, starting in spring 2027 and completing by 2034, reflects a commitment to revitalizing the airport without disrupting current operations.
